The NASDAQ-100 is a modified market-cap weighted index of the 100 largest non-financial companies on NASDAQ, dominated by technology, communication services and consumer technology firms.
NAS100 is driven by Fed policy, Treasury yields, mega-cap technology earnings, the AI cycle, CPI, NFP, GDP, PCE inflation, regulatory risk and global risk sentiment.
Rate cuts can support NAS100, while tightening can pressure growth stock valuations.
Rising yields can weigh on tech valuations, while falling yields often support growth stocks.
Apple, Microsoft, Nvidia, Alphabet, Amazon, Meta and Tesla can move the whole index.
AI infrastructure, chips, cloud and data-centre spending are major NAS100 catalysts.
CPI affects Fed expectations and can trigger fast NAS100 reactions.
NFP can move NAS100 through the labour market and rate-cut expectation channel.
Antitrust and regulatory actions against big tech can create downside risk.
NAS100 is a high-beta risk-on index that can fall sharply during market stress.
NAS100 follows NASDAQ regular session hours, with major US data and Fed events often released around the US session.
Monday to Friday, 1:30 PM to 8:00 PM GMT, corresponding to 9:30 AM to 4:00 PM ET.
CPI and NFP are commonly released at 1:30 PM GMT and can trigger immediate NAS100 volatility.
Fed rate decisions are typically released at 6:00 PM GMT and can move NAS100 sharply.
